Newell Brands Acquires Elmer s Products

On October 22, 2015, Newell Brands acquired consumer products company Elmer s Products from Berwind for 600M USD

Newell Brands is a marketer of consumer and commercial products. The Company's portfolio of leading brands include Rubbermaid, Sharpie, Graco, Calphalon, Irwin, Lenox, Levolor, Paper Mate, Dymo, Waterman, Parker, Goody, Rubbermaid Commercial Products and Aprica. Newell Brands was formerly known as Newell Rubbermaid. Newell Brands was founded in 1903 and is based in Atlanta, Georgia.

Berwind Corporation is a family-owned private investment firm focused on building a diversified portfolio of highly successful manufacturing and service companies. Target companies should be leaders in their respective markets, with strong organic growth prospects, and consistently high margins. Specific areas of interest include pharmaceutical, specialty chemical, office and craft, automotive, and natural resources. Acquisitions of any size are considered if they are assimilated into an existing Berwind company. Potential new platform companies range in value between $200 and $900 million. Berwind Corporation dates back to 1886 and is based in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.
